PNV: Social-networking Websites and Community Access to Information

How much do social-networking websites further the cause of better community access to information, atleast among the large connected communities? And how much do they hurt that cause by mis-framing the issues? What about deliberate obfuscations through information-overload?

We think that at the end, the websites contribute positively by bridging the information-gaps and making the uncertain familiar. That is also why our vote-based approach to planning news is important. Anthony Williams of 'Wikinomics: How Mass Collaboration Changes Everything' seems to agree.
